Approaches for Removing Debris and Contaminants
Reliable approaches for clearing away debris and contaminants from ponds and lakes play a critical role in sustaining water quality and ecosystem health. Among the most frequently-employed methods are mechanical removal and chemical treatments. Mechanical removal involves using specialized equipment, such as skimmers and dredgers, to physically remove debris like leaves, algae, and sediment from the water. This approach minimizes disruption to the aquatic environment while effectively diminishing pollutant levels.
Chemical treatment methods, such as algaecides and herbicides, can eliminate specific contaminants but should be applied cautiously to minimize harming non-target species. Biological approaches, including introducing beneficial microorganisms, present an eco-friendly alternative for breaking down organic waste and pollutants.
Regular monitoring of water quality can inform the implementation of these approaches, ensuring ideal results. By adopting a combination of these techniques, pond and lake managers can substantially enhance the health and sustainability of aquatic ecosystems.

Enhancing Water Quality for Wildlife
While the health of aquatic ecosystems is essential for supporting varied wildlife, bettering water quality remains a primary challenge for pond and lake managers. High nutrient levels, often stemming from runoff, can result in harmful algal blooms that reduce oxygen and jeopardize aquatic life. Effective management practices emphasize reducing these nutrient inputs through buffer zones and sediment control.
In addition, sustaining ideal pH levels and temperature is crucial for the well-being of vulnerable species. Administrators often monitor these parameters closely to guarantee a balanced ecosystem. The establishment of native plant species can enhance water filtration and create habitats for fish and invertebrates, consequently supporting biodiversity.
Regular assessments and adjustments to management strategies are required, as conditions can change rapidly. In the end, the commitment to enhancing water quality not only benefits wildlife but also boosts the recreational value of water bodies for the area population.

Eco-Friendly Cleaning Approaches
Contemporary pond and lake management more and more highlights natural cleaning methods, which leverage the strength of ecosystems to reinstate water quality without harmful chemicals. These approaches include the introduction of beneficial bacteria and enzymes that disintegrate organic matter, therefore promoting a balanced ecosystem. Aquatic plants fulfill a crucial purpose by absorbing excess nutrients, which supports controlling alg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can sustain a healthy aquatic environment. Regularly aerating the water enhances oxygen levels, enabling the breakdown article of pollutants. By implementing these natural techniques, water bodies can reach improved clarity and health while conserving the delicate balance of their ecosystems, ultimately resulting in sustainable and effective management practices.
